It’s not Otumfuo’s job to invest in Asante Kotoko – Herbert Mensah

Former Asante Kotoko chairman, Herbert Mensah says it is not the responsibility of His Royal Majesty Otumfuo Osei Tutu II to invest in the club.

His comment comes following the Porcupine Warriors visit to Manhyia on Wednesday, June 18, 2025. The veteran football administrator was part of the Kotoko delegation that presented the FA Cup trophy to the life patron of the club.

Mensah, who is the president of Ghana Rugby Association left an indelible mark during his spell with the Porcupine Warriors. He served as the chairman of Kotoko from 1999 to 2002, helping the club to lift FA Cup title and missing out on the CAF Winners Cup to Wydad Casablanca.

Making a strong case for Otumfuo, Herbert Mensah stressed that it is the duty of the leadership of the team to invest in the club not the life patron.

“Everywhere you go there is a greatness in Kotoko because of Otumfuo. Too many people have forgotten they think you are playing football but it more than football. You represent the spirit of Asanteman. If you only playing football, you are playing for the wrong team”

“Otumfuo has dreams bigger than you can imagine. When I travel the world, everybody talks about Asante Kotoko and at the same time, they talk about Otumfuo”

“You must back up, be at the World Club championship and bring the glory back. Otumfuo has invested, but it is not Otumfuo’s job to invest in Kotoko rather it is what Kotoko achieve and those who hold it must invest. It is an honour, privilege to hold Kotoko” he said.

Asante Kotoko will compete in the CAF Confederation Cup next season following their Ghana FA Cup success in the just ended campaign.
